Gay Porn’s Version of In Cold Blood: Harlow and Joe Claim They Didn’t Off Bryan Kocis

WILKES-BARRE – Accused killers Harlow Cuadra and Joseph Kerekes had plenty to say last week shortly before pleading not guilty to killing Bryan Kocis.

A subdued Mr. Cuadra maintained his innocence, saying “I didn’t kill him,” and that it was “not right” the Luzerne County district attorney’s office was seeking the death penalty in the case. The 26-year-old also insinuated two men named Brian and Grant knew more than he did about the murder.

A much more defiant Mr. Kerekes verbally attacked the Pennsylvania State Police as he was escorted into the courthouse by sheriff’s deputies for seizing his and Mr. Cuadra’s assets. The 33-year-old said he believes money was taken from him and Mr. Cuadra – his romantic and business partner – in order to limit the quality of defense they can mount against the charges.

“I’m very angry they took $200,000 of our money,” Mr. Kerekes said emphatically. “We need money for an adequate defense.”

Luzerne County Assistant District Attorney Tim Doherty declined to comment on Mr. Kerekes’ allegations, citing Luzerne County Judge Peter Paul Olszewski Jr.’s order that limits attorneys from publicly discussing aspects of the case.

As for the plea, Mr. Kocis’ parents were in the front row of the courtroom, looking on when attorneys for both Mr. Cuadra and Mr. Kerekes said their clients were not guilty and wanted a trial.

When Judge Olszewski asked Mr. Kerekes how he wanted to plead, he started to say “absolutely not” before he was interrupted by attorney Jonathan Blum, his public defender. Mr. Blum, not Mr. Kerekes, entered the plea. Mr. Kerekes later asked if he could say something. Judge Olszewski turned to him and said “no.”

Attorneys Frank and Joseph Nocito had been retained by Mr. Kerekes, but they are “no longer involved” in the case, Frank Nocito said after Thursday’s proceedings. Although Frank Nocito did not provide a reason, Mr. Kerekes hinted that he and Mr. Cuadra were out of money when he shouted out the name of two Web sites where supporters could donate money to pay for their defense.

Judge Olszewski set a March 24 trial date and scheduled a Dec. 21 status conference in the case. There are several issues that will likely need to be addressed before any trial could begin.

In addition, the district attorney’s office announced its intentions to jointly try Mr. Cuadra and Mr. Kerekes for Mr. Kocis’ murder. A similar attempt at a joint trial in another Luzerne County murder case, involving suspects Hugo Selenski and Paul Weakley, was denied by Judge Chester Muroski. The decision has been appealed to the state Superior Court.

Defense attorneys for Mr. Cuadra and Mr. Kerekes could fight for separate trials as well.

Mr. Blum also made a motion to have Mr. Cuadra moved from the Lackawanna County Correctional Facility to the Luzerne County Correctional Facility. Mr. Blum indicated it would be easier for the public defenders’ office to meet with Mr. Cuadra if he was kept at the Water Street jail in Wilkes-Barre until his trial.

Mr. Doherty and Assistant District Attorney Michael Melnick told Judge Olszewski that Mr. Cuadra is jailed in Lackawanna County to keep him apart from Mr. Kerekes apart. Judge Olszewski directed Mr. Doherty and Mr. Melnick to talk to Luzerne County Warden Gene Fischi. If Mr. Cuadra and Mr. Kerekes could be held without the opportunity to interact, Judge Olszewski wants Mr. Cuadra moved back to Luzerne County prison.
